  • Melting Point of PET Film Technical Data

    The melting point of PET film is generally 250°C–265°C, with 255°C–260°C used as a common industrial reference range. This value shows when the crystalline PET base film begins to melt. In actual converting, the film should not be judged by melting point alone. More practical data include PET film service temperature, glass transition range, thermal…
